I thought VS2008 form designer was WYSIWYG. It appears not to be though, and I dont know what to do about it.
I have looked at some properties of the form and of the components placed on it (ListViews, linklabels etc) trying to find out if there is a property that is causing this behaviour. I got somewhat closer to WYSIWYG by setting "None" as anchor on all components, but some components still has a somewhat different position when running the application compared to design mode. Is there a downside with setting anchor property to "None" on all components that are contained in the form (my FormBorderStyle is FixedToolWindow, so the user will not be able to resize the form)? Is there a better way of getting WYSIWYG (that works on all components on the form)? As it is now, it all seems so arbitrary how my GUI ends up looking at runtime.
